‘This is your campaign’ Miriam Dalli calls for all citizens’ participat­ion to ‘take country to the next level’

-

MEP Miriam Dalli is encouragin­g Maltese and Gozitans to actively take part in her election campaign by submitting their ideas on the themes they believe should be a priority during the next legislatur­e of the European Parliament.

“I will launch my election campaign on 8 March. This will be your campaign because I want to put your priorities at the forefront. Tell me the themes you consider to be of priority,” she said in a message, launched during a political activity in Zabbar, that is accessible on social media.

“On what issues do you want me to focus? How do you feel we can take this country to the next level?” she asked.

The Labour MEP is contesting the European Parliament elections for the second time. During the last five years, Dr Dalli has made Malta a priority. This was evident in her work on matters such as taxation, the environmen­t, innovation and irregular migration, whilst defending the national interest even when the European Parliament took a stand against Malta.

“I come before you with a vision based on what you would like to see as a priority. The Labour government has strengthen­ed this country’s economic foundation­s during these six years and now is the time to take the next step – the next level for Malta. This is my aspiration,” Dalli said.

The MEP is inviting all citizens to have their say on where they would like the country to make the leap to the next level regarding quality of life, standards, education and the environmen­t, amongst others.

“This is not my campaign but the campaign of each and every one of you because these islands, and the Maltese and Gozitans, deserve the best possible.”
